The electric road gets bumpy for Tesla shares
Tesla Stock Takes a Tumble: Overvaluation, Tech Risks, and Competition in the Spotlight!
Tesla's stock is under pressure amid concerns over its high valuation, reliance on speculative autonomous technology, increasing competition in key markets like China, and CEO Elon Musk's controversial political activities. The stock's consensus rating has shifted towards 'Sell' as analysts and investors scrutinize these challenges.
